H-1B sponsorship profile: William Newton Hospital. Across U.S. Department of Labor LCA disclosures, William Newton Hospital filed 3 Labor Condition Applications covering 3 H-1B worker positions between fiscal year 2023 and fiscal year 2026. The employer’s DOL certification rate sits at 100% (3 certified of 3 filed), a useful proxy for how cleanly their prevailing-wage attestations pass the Labor Department’s preliminary review before USCIS adjudication.
Compensation spread. Offered wages on William Newton Hospital’s H-1B petitions range from $64,168 at the low end to $69,285 at the high end, with a petition-weighted average of $66,671. That range reflects the mix of occupations the company sponsors, led by Medical Technologist (3 petitions at $66,671 avg). H-1B salaries reported on LCAs must meet or exceed the DOL prevailing wage for the role and worksite, so the spread also tracks wage-level geography and seniority.
Geographic footprint. William Newton Hospital is headquartered in Winfield, KS under NAICS code 622110, and places H-1B workers across 1 state, most heavily in KS. Combined, these signals give a granular view of how one employer uses the H-1B program, volume, approval cleanliness, wage posture, and where the jobs actually sit on the map.
Where William Newton Hospital ranks. By H-1B petition volume, William Newton Hospital is #37,433 of 119,880 employers nationally and #204 of 654 employers headquartered in KS. Both ranks are computed live from the same underlying petition counts, not a separate estimate.
